jdk1.7.0_15 问题描述 已经在用的接口服务器,接收另一个web端传来的des对称加密的信息,然后接口解密再进行处理。 最近小程序上线,也需要调用改接口,需要用js进行参数加密进行接口调用。 如果上述第一种情况,都可以使用java 的SecretKeyFactory进行参数加密解密 那么如何使用js进行des的参数对称加密 首先要搞明白SecretKeyFactory关键的加密方法,如下图 指定为des查询,因为之前使用的加密解密最后的密文都是hex码的大写. 所以在js最终结果上也要
2024-11-26iOS开发中的方向包含两个:设备方向(Device orientation),界面方向(Interface orientation) 设备方向 也就是手机的方向,对应于枚举UIDeviceOrientation typedef enum { UIDeviceOrientationUnknown, UIDeviceOrientationPortrait, UIDeviceOrientationPortraitUpsideDown, UIDeviceOrientationLandscapeLeft
2024-11-26第一章 简介 今天,为大家带来的事基于微信小程序的校园商铺系统。本系统的主要意义在于,全力以赴为用户提供一个操作方便,界面简洁,信息直观的网上交易系统。使用该系统的用户,可以先浏览到最新上架的新品和最热门的产品,并可以注册成为本网站的用户,可以利用购物车选择自己想买的产品,然后向商铺提交订单,从而完成网上的交易流程。 第二章 技术栈 前端:小程序 开发语言:Java 框架:ssm,mybatis JDK版本:JDK1.8 数据库:mysql 5.7+ 数据库工具:Navicat11+ 开发
2024-11-26在 Swift 中有个有趣的现象:它没有与线程相关的语法,也没有明确的互斥锁/锁(mutexes/locks)概念,甚至 Objective-C 中有的 @synchronized 和原子属性它都没有。幸运的是,苹果系统的 API 可以非常容易地应用到 Swift 中。今天,我会介绍这些 API 的用法以及从 Objective-C 过渡的一些问题,这些灵感都来源于 Cameron Pulsford。 快速回顾一下锁 锁(lock)或者互斥锁(mutex)是一种结构,用来保证一段代码在同一时刻只
2024-11-26前言 Google推出flutter这样一个新的高性能跨平台(Android,ios)快速开发框架之后,被业界许多开发者所关注。我在接触了flutter之后发现这个确实是一个好东西,好东西当然要和大家分享,对吧。 今天要跟大家分享的是Json反序列化的实现。相信做app的同学都会遇到这么一个问题,在向服务器请求数据后,服务器往往会返回一段json字符串。而我们要想更加灵活的使用数据的话需要把json字符串转化成对象。由于flutter只提供了json to Map。而手写反序列化在大型项目中极不
2024-11-26个人类型和海外类型的小程序不支持 web-view 标签 也就是说个人申请的小程序,就别想跳转了!!!! 1.开发的时候,我们难免碰到要跳转到其他网页中去那该怎么实现呢? 2.例如我想点击一个按钮,跳转到百度(百度的网页还是在小程序中打开) 3.wxml 1. index.wxml (按钮页面) <view class='wrapper'> <button class='wepay' bindtap='goBaidu'>点击跳转</button> </view>
2024-11-26在HBuilderX中开发的uni-app应用,运行到微信开发者工具,在微信开发者工具中报错:{“errMsg”:“chooseAddress:fail the api need to be declared in the requiredPrivateInfos field in app.json/ext.json”} 现在,运行到微信开发者工具,会自动在app.json文件中增加如下片段: "requiredPrivateInfos": [ "chooseAddress"
2024-11-26前置环境:首先确保你的电脑当中已安装node环境并且npm没有问题,如果没有可看另一篇博文前半部分安装node教程: 1,创建一个普通的微信小程序项目 2,打开项目终端新建终端 3,输入 npm init -y 初始化包 4,通过 npm 安装 vant, 在终端继续输入: npm i @vant/weapp -S --production 回车 5,修改 app.json 把app.json当中的”style“:v2删除掉 将 app.json 中的"style": "v2"去
2024-11-26使用前须知: 你已经引入了ucharts你已经使用ucharts的“演示-微信”部分的代码 直接上解决方法: data: { opts: { ... update: true } }, 当update: true时,即你使用chartData更新的数据不会使界面重新渲染,只会更新数据 当update: false或不传时,即你使用chartData更新的数据会让界面重新渲染 思路: 在开发微信小程序charts有需求需要不断请求后
2024-11-260 开发需求 想用getUnlimitedQRCode得到能直接访问到小程序某一页的二维码,先用postman试试,最后是成功得到了二维码。 1 测试软件 用 postman 测试 2 错误总结 41001 "access_token missing"——access_token写错了地方 或者 access_token过期41030 "invalid page"——没写"check_path": false44002 "empty post data"——看的别人的文章 2.1 41001报
2024-11-26